The ASUS RT-AX57 is a dual-band Wi-Fi router that provides 160MHz bandwidth. With up to 4X higher network capacity, it can handle more streaming, gaming, and smart home devices simultaneously. The more efficient transmission scheduling can also greatly extend the battery life of your IoT gadgets and reduce network congestion. Disclaimer: Actual data throughput and WiFi coverage will vary from network conditions and environmental factors, including the volume of network traffic, building material and construction, and network overhead, result in lower actual data throughput and wireless coverage.
New-Gen WiFi Standard – Supporting 802.11ax WiFi standard for better efficiency and throughput.
Ultra-fast WiFi Speed – RT-AX57 supports 1024-QAM for dramatically faster wireless connections. With a total networking speed of about 3000Mbps — 574 Mbps on the 2.4GHz band and 2402 Mbps on the 5GHz band.
Increase Capacity and Efficiency – Supporting not only MU-MIMO but also OFDMA technique to efficiently allocate channels, communicating with multiple devices simultaneously.
Commercial-grade Security Anywhere – Protect your home network with AiProtection Classic, powered by Trend Micro. And when away from home, ASUS Instant Guard gives you a one-click secure VPN.
Easy Extendable Network – Enjoy seamless roaming with rich, advanced features by adding any AiMesh-compatible router.

    Capable Little Router for Simple Needs
    For anyone who just needs to connect to the Internet simply and securely, then this RT-AX57 will readily deliver. Either the companion app or web ui (both fully featured) will easily get things up and running, and the built-in, FREE antimalware offers an extra layer of protection if not peace of mind. Performance, for the most part, was great, although in my case, not perfect. Signal was strong throughout my small Cape Cod style house. The router was in the first floor, north side of my home, and my PC is on the second floor, south side. My PC was able to fully utilize the entire 500down/20up Mbs of my data plan. My Pixel 6, with its relatively weaker antennas, hovered roughly around 300/18 at similar distances.That was with QoS turned off, however. With QoS turned on, no device, including one wired PC, would go past 270/16. My brother and I game regularly, and halving download speeds for multi-gig updates for our games was supremely inconvenient. Turning QoS off to get higher bandwidth introduced frequent lag spikes. Due to this, I sadly decided to return the RT-AX57 and replaced it with a much more capable (and expensive) Asus XT8 two-pack. The XT8 consistently delivers about 480up/18down with QoS turned on, which is expected since QoS should prevent a single device from hogging the entire bandwidth.I also had issues with a couple of smart bulbs and a smart plug regularly disconnecting. They are older models, however, and from an off-brand that I bought from 5 Below. These issues have been fixed with the XT8, but anyone with smart devices from reputable big brands I doubt would have the same issues. Still another reason for me to return the RT-AX57.If I lived by myself and didn’t own a couple of off-brand smart appliances, I’d be plenty happy with the RT-AX57. It has all the perks of a basic WiFi 6 router (OFDMA, WPA3, enhanced MU-MIMO, 160Mhz, 1024 QAM, etc) with the addition of FREE antimalware, but the QoS and smart appliance issues killed it for me. I’d still recommend the RT-AX57, though, for households with modest needs.
